> Since the OpenSolaris Automated Installer is being enhanced to create 
> zfs pools, setting properties of zfs filesystems and pools should also 
> be considered.
> 
> A zfs root pool is created automatically when OpenSolaris is installed, 
> and the design proposal includes creating other zfs pools and extending 
> them to multiple disks.
> 
> This message suggests possibilities for new features for the the 
> OpenSolaris Automated Installer.  Community input is requested.
> 

I'm not clear on what you're proposing, exactly, but it appears that 
you're suggesting something other than just passing through a list of 
ZFS properties.  The concern I would have about any other approach is 
that the ZFS property list is extensible, including user properties, and 
so I'm skeptical there's value added by AI knowing anything about the 
specifics of the properties.

> zfs filesystem specification - suggest:
> 
> compression - turn on and select the compression algorithm
> mountpoint - where the zfs filesystem will be mounted on the new system
> quota - set file system quota
> 
> A zfs upgrade could also be specified, so that a new OpenSolaris is 
> installed and an old zfs filesystem could be upgraded at the same time.  
> The same logic might apply to snapshots - upgrade OpenSolaris and take 
> snapshots of existing file systems.
> 
> zfs file systems could be configured for sharing via nfs or smb.
> 
> zfs file system properties casesensitivity, normalization, and utf8only 
> cannot be changed once the file system is created, and should perhaps be 
> provided for this reason alone.
> 
> User and group access permissions can be set.
> 
> zpool property: failmode - control behavior if failure
> 
> zpools can be upgraded and snapshots taken as well.
> 
> vdevs can be added to or removed from existing zpools.
> 
> There are many other possible zfs-related features to be offered.  
> Suggest starting by supporting a basic set of the most useful ones, as 
> they can become complex to implementand validate, and can complicate 
> installation, possibly leading to failure due to small technicality in 
> less important options.
